Over the past 0 day period starting on November 18, 2024, sportsci.org's availability has been checked 0 times. Each assessment found sportsci.org to be facing technical issues or experiencing downtime as of November 18, 2024. No periods of non-functionality were detected for sportsci.org across all inspections done as of November 18, 2024. According to replies, as of November 18, 2024, all responses were received without any error statuses. Contrary to the 0.000 seconds average response time, sportsci.org's response on November 18, 2024, was 0 seconds.